Bari Ilachi

Bari Ilachi, also known as black cardamom or brown cardamom, is a striking spice with a smoky, resinous flavor that distinguishes it from green cardamom. These large, dark brown pods have a tough, wrinkled exterior and encapsulate small, sticky, dark seeds. The aroma is intense and earthy, often described as having hints of camphor and menthol. The unique, pungent flavor profile of black cardamom makes it ideal for adding depth and complexity to savory dishes.

Common Uses

  • Black cardamom is frequently used to enhance the flavor of rich, slow-cooked stews and braises, lending a warming smokiness that complements hearty meats and vegetables.
  • Add whole black cardamom pods to broths and soups for an infusion of smoky flavor; remove the pods before serving.
  • Black cardamom can be lightly toasted and ground to use as a unique element in spice blends for rubs and marinades, especially for grilled or roasted meats.
  • The distinctive, smoky notes of black cardamom are perfect for flavoring rice dishes, especially biryanis and pilafs, adding a layer of savory depth.
  • Crush a black cardamom pod lightly and infuse it in hot milk or tea for a warming, aromatic beverage.
  • Grind black cardamom and combine it with other spices to make Garam Masala for Indian dishes.

Storage Tips

Store bari ilachi (black cardamom) in an airtight container in a cool, dark, and dry place. This will protect it from moisture and light, which can degrade its flavor and aroma. Properly stored, it can maintain its quality for up to a year. Avoid storing it near strong-smelling spices, as it can absorb their odors.
